This dinner salad is incredibly satisfying! Chicken, bacon, onion, cilantro, avocado - a delicious combination of flavors that really hits the spot. This is one of my six year old's favorite dinners, and that says a lot!
Cook chicken breasts according to package instructions.
While chicken is cooking, prepare fresh ingredients. Dice the onion; cook and crumble the bacon; spin your lettuce; chop your cilantro.
If you don't already have your dressing made ( you should always have some Satisfying Salad Dressing on hand) now is the time.
When the chicken is done, slice into 1-inch cubes.
Place your lettuce in a bowl and top with chicken, bacon, onion, and cilantro. When you are ready to serve, cube and add your avocado, then toss with dressing.
The chicken does not have to be hot to serve this salad! Often I will prepare all the ingredients a day or two before, then when my avocados are ripe, I will add everything to a bowl, cube the avocados and add the dressing. It is the ultimate quick meal for those tight evenings!
